Communauté Play-Arena


    Fonctions LCD Hype Fail

    Partagez

    AlgaboW

    Nombre de messages : 6
    Age : 29
    OS Principal : Seven

    Fonctions LCD Hype Fail

    Message par AlgaboW le Lun 13 Sep 2010 - 17:11

    Bonjour, je code en ce moment mon propre script pour LCD Hype sur un portable Asus G50V, mais voila ces fonctions ne fonctionne pas:
    %BattPercent()
    %CpuTemp()
    %GpuUsed() ( Je cois que sa existe pas )
    %GpuTemp()

    Cependant ces fonctions fonctionnent:
    %CpuUsed()
    %RamUsed()

    J'ai installer everest, qui détecte très bien les températures CPU / GPU, comme SpeedFan d'ailleurs :s

    Quel sont les script a intégrer pour faire fonctionner ces fonctions ? :s
    avatar
    Supermario

    Nombre de messages : 200
    Age : 33
    OS Principal : Seven
    Script OLED : Autre script LCDHype

    Re: Fonctions LCD Hype Fail

    Message par Supermario le Mar 14 Sep 2010 - 13:14

    tout d'abord, quel version de lcdhype tu utilises??
    as-tu un fichier scriptengine.xml dans le dossier de ton plugin everest et dans celui du plugin battery??

    AlgaboW

    Nombre de messages : 6
    Age : 29
    OS Principal : Seven

    Re: Fonctions LCD Hype Fail

    Message par AlgaboW le Mar 14 Sep 2010 - 18:40

    LCD Hype Version: 0.7.3.17

    J'ai réussi en ajoutant le fichier XML a faire fonctionner le plugin battery.

    Par contre everest me pose des problèmes :
    Dans LCDHype j'ai bien dans les plugins everest avec everest.dll et scriptengine.xml.
    Et everest est parametrer sur "memoire partager", et tout est cocher dans "application externe".

    Dans LCDHype je vois everest dans les plugins, avec plein de fonction mais elle marquent le plus souvent "no data available" !

    exemple:
    Temperature de la carte graphique 1 ?
    %Plugin.Everest.TEMP.TGPU1AMB(Output) -> wrong parameter

    avatar
    Supermario

    Nombre de messages : 200
    Age : 33
    OS Principal : Seven
    Script OLED : Autre script LCDHype

    Re: Fonctions LCD Hype Fail

    Message par Supermario le Mar 14 Sep 2010 - 21:49

    A première vue ton souci vient de ton fichier xml.
    Voici le fichier que j'utilise:
    Code:
    <?xml version="1.0" encoding="utf-8"?>
    <ScriptEngine>
      <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SCPUCLK</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SCPUCLK"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SCPUCLK"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.TCPU</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="TCPU"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="TCPU"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>


    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SCPUFSB</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SCPUFSB"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SCPUFSB"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SCPUMUL</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SCPUMUL"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SCPUMUL"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>


    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.TGPU1DIO</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="TGPU1DIO"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="TGPU1DIO"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SGPU1CLK</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SGPU1CLK"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SGPU1CLK"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>


      <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SGPU1SHDCLK</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SGPU1SHDCLK"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SGPU1SHDCLK"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>


    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SGPU1MEMCLK</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SGPU1MEMCLK"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SGPU1MEMCLK"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>


    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SGPU1UTI</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SGPU1UTI"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SGPU1UTI"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>


    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.FCPU</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="FCPU"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="FCPU"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SCPUUTI</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SCPUUTI"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SCPUUTI"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SCPU1UTI</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SCPU1UTI"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SCPU1UTI"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SCPU2UTI</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SCPU2UTI"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SCPU2UTI"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.VCPU</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="VCPU"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="VCPU"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>


    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SMEMCLK</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SMEMCLK"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SMEMCLK"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    <Element Type="etPlugin" Target="plugins\everest\everest.dll">
        <EvaluationString>Plugin.Everest.SMEMTIM</EvaluationString>
        <Documentation Source="parameters.htm" />
        <FunctionTree>
          <Branch Name="Plugins">
            <Branch Name="Everest">         
                <Leaf Name="SMEMTIM" />         
            </Branch>
          </Branch>
        </FunctionTree>
        <Parameter Kind="pkHidden" Format="pfReservedWord" Name="SensorID" Value="SMEMTIM" />
        <Parameter Format="pfReservedWord" Name="Output" Value="value" />
      </Element>

    </ScriptEngine>

    Et voici l'appel des fonctions du plugin everest dans lcdhype:
    Code:
    %CleanUp.Free(CpuTemp)
    %DefFunc(CpuTemp, Global=%Plugin.Everest.TCPU(value))
    %CleanUp.Free(GpuTemp)
    %DefFunc(GpuTemp, Global=%Plugin.Everest.TGPU1DIO(value))
    %CleanUp.Free(CpuMul)
    %DefFunc(CpuMul, Global=%Plugin.Everest.SCPUMUL(value))
    %CleanUp.Free(CpuFsb)
    %DefFunc(CpuFsb, Global=%Plugin.Everest.SCPUFSB(value))
    %CleanUp.Free(CpuClk)
    %DefFunc(CpuClk, Global=%Plugin.Everest.SCPUCLK(value))
    %CleanUp.Free(CpuUti)
    %DefFunc(CpuUti, Global=%Plugin.Everest.SCPUUTI(value))
    %CleanUp.Free(MemClk)
    %DefFunc(MemClk, Global=%Plugin.Everest.SMEMCLK(value))
    %CleanUp.Free(MemTim)
    %DefFunc(MemTim, Global=%Plugin.Everest.SMEMTIM(value))
    %CleanUp.Free(Gpu)
    %DefFunc(Gpu, Global=%Plugin.Everest.SGPU1CLK(value))
    %CleanUp.Free(GpuClk)
    %DefFunc(GpuClk, Global=%Round(%Div(%Mul(%Gpu(),92.6),100)))
    %CleanUp.Free(GpuShd)
    %DefFunc(GpuShd, Global=%Plugin.Everest.SGPU1SHDCLK(value))
    %CleanUp.Free(GpuShdClk)
    %DefFunc(GpuShdClk, Global=%Round(%Div(%Mul(%GpuShd(),92.6),100)))
    %CleanUp.Free(GpuMemClk)
    %DefFunc(GpuMemClk, Global=%Plugin.Everest.SGPU1MEMCLK(value))
    %CleanUp.Free(GpuUti)
    %DefFunc(GpuUti, Global=%Plugin.Everest.SGPU1UTI(value))
    %CleanUp.Free(FCpu)
    %DefFunc(FCpu, Global=%Plugin.Everest.FCPU(value))
    %CleanUp.Free(VCpu)
    %DefFunc(VCpu, Global=%Plugin.Everest.VCPU(value))

    Et je t'assure que tout fonctionne
    Essaye avec tout ca et dit moi ce que ca donne.

    AlgaboW

    Nombre de messages : 6
    Age : 29
    OS Principal : Seven

    Re: Fonctions LCD Hype Fail

    Message par AlgaboW le Mer 15 Sep 2010 - 10:57

    Sa marche ! Merci
    Par contre j'ai tester les fonctions se rapportant au GPU, mais je ne sais pas a quoi cela correspond, j'aimerai savoir, si c'est possible le % d'utilisation de la carte graphique, comme le fait CpuUsed() -> GpuUsed().

    Possible ?
    avatar
    Supermario

    Nombre de messages : 200
    Age : 33
    OS Principal : Seven
    Script OLED : Autre script LCDHype

    Re: Fonctions LCD Hype Fail

    Message par Supermario le Mer 15 Sep 2010 - 12:32

    Dans le code que je t'ai donné c'est "GpuUti".

    il faut avoir la version 5 de everest au minimum pour avoir cette valeur.

    "GpuClk" fréquence du coeur
    "GpuShdClk" fréquence des shaders
    "GpuMemClk" fréquence de la mémoire
    "GpuTemp" température du gpu


    AlgaboW

    Nombre de messages : 6
    Age : 29
    OS Principal : Seven

    Re: Fonctions LCD Hype Fail

    Message par AlgaboW le Mer 15 Sep 2010 - 13:30

    Parfait sa marche avec la dernière version everest, juste une dernière chose, j'ai essayer des scriptengine.xml et tout mais rien a faire Fraps n'est pas détecter dans LCDHype, tu peut me copiercoller ske ta ? J'ai fraps 2.
    avatar
    Supermario

    Nombre de messages : 200
    Age : 33
    OS Principal : Seven
    Script OLED : Autre script LCDHype

    Re: Fonctions LCD Hype Fail

    Message par Supermario le Mer 15 Sep 2010 - 18:44

    AH je n'utilises pas fraps avec lcdhype.
    Je l'ai essayé a mes débuts avec lcdhype mais j'ai très vite abandonné.Le plugin est buggé.

    Pour fraps je me contente de la version normale en affichage sur l'écran. désolé.

    Je vais préparer une petite vidéo de mon travail sur lcdype pour voir si ca intéresse du monde et j'en ferai une version un peu plus tard.

    AlgaboW

    Nombre de messages : 6
    Age : 29
    OS Principal : Seven

    Re: Fonctions LCD Hype Fail

    Message par AlgaboW le Mer 15 Sep 2010 - 20:02

    Pas grave, je vais chercher par moi même un peu et sinon bah tant pis !
    Voila mon lcdhype, avec 1 seul mode d'affichage sa me suffit ^^



    A + !
    avatar
    Supermario

    Nombre de messages : 200
    Age : 33
    OS Principal : Seven
    Script OLED : Autre script LCDHype

    Re: Fonctions LCD Hype Fail

    Message par Supermario le Mer 15 Sep 2010 - 20:10

    Tu as déjà vu le script que j'avais mis en ligne il y a quelques temps??

    http://play-arena.go-forum.net/lcdhype-et-g50-f15/nouvelle-version-lcdhype0711-t289.htm

    AlgaboW

    Nombre de messages : 6
    Age : 29
    OS Principal : Seven

    Re: Fonctions LCD Hype Fail

    Message par AlgaboW le Mer 15 Sep 2010 - 20:18

    Ah non je connait que le gros script de Stouf, il est pas mal aussi le tient sa va ^^
    Bon maintenant que j'ai fait le mien plus besoin ...

    Dis moi, ta un G50V comme moi, donc de base avec Vista.
    Moi quand j'ai formater et remis seven, j'ai réinstaller un max de drivers, tout remarche sauf la webcam !
    Jpeut même pas essayer d'installer les drivers du site Asus il détecte pas de cam, elle est invisible même du gestionnaire de périph et de everest Sad
    J'ai perdu ma cam' en gros, et toi ?
    avatar
    Supermario

    Nombre de messages : 200
    Age : 33
    OS Principal : Seven
    Script OLED : Autre script LCDHype

    Re: Fonctions LCD Hype Fail

    Message par Supermario le Mer 15 Sep 2010 - 20:24

    Ben il me semble que ces un des seuls périph qui sont détecté automatiquement par seven.
    Elle marche très bien...

    Contenu sponsorisé

    Re: Fonctions LCD Hype Fail

    Message par Contenu sponsorisé


      La date/heure actuelle est Ven 22 Sep 2017 - 10:04